Browserbase. Apify. Stagehand. Playwright Cloud. They all drive a browser they own. That means your cookies, your auth tokens, your live session — sitting on infrastructure you don't control. It isn't a bug. It's the only way their architecture can work.
Taprun compiles your task into an 18-op deterministic plan — a small JSON program AI never re-reads. Your Chrome replays it. The bill stops at compile time.
Point AI at a URL with intent. It probes JSON-LD, OpenAPI, RSS, ARIA — stable structural addresses, not fragile CSS selectors. It writes a Plan.
Your real Chrome — already logged in, already trusted — runs the plan locally. No tokens. No cloud round-trip. No "session expired" mid-flow.
When the site changes, snapshot-equivalence tells you before your pipeline notices. Re-capture heals it in seconds.

tap verify is read-only. It compares today's substrate to your baseline snapshot through a per-tap predicate you wrote. The verdict is one of four, always.

Taprun is MIT-licensed, written in TypeScript on Deno, ships as a single signed binary. The Chrome extension is an open extension. No license server, no phone-home, no usage telemetry.
